West Worcestershire — 2024

Harriett Baldwin (Conservative Party) was elected with 19,783 votes36.2% of 54,687 valid votes. Under First Past the Post, a plurality is enough; a majority is not required.

1Harriett Baldwin Conservative Party 19,78336.2%−13.8 ptsElected
2Dan Boatright-Greene Liberal Democrats 13,23624.2%
3Kash Haroon Labour Party 8,33515.2%
4Christopher Edmondson Reform UK 7,90214.4%
5Natalie McVey Green Party 5,0689.3%
6Seonaid Barber Party of Women 3630.7%

Electorate 79,246 · Turnout 69.0% · Majority 6,547 · Back to 2024 overview
